The pace at which a marital dissolution concludes within the state hinges totally on statutory ready durations and the diploma of settlement between the events. A minimal of 60 days should elapse from the date the divorce petition is filed with the court docket earlier than a last decree will be granted. This era is designed to permit for reflection and potential reconciliation. As an illustration, if a pair information on January 1st, the earliest a divorce will be finalized is March 2nd, supplied all different necessities are met.

The period of this course of is essential as a result of it gives a safeguard in opposition to impulsive choices and encourages settlement negotiations. In Texas, a dissolution of marriage can happen when one occasion’s actions are deemed liable for the marital breakdown. Any such authorized motion requires demonstrating particular misconduct that led to the irreparable hurt of the connection. Examples of such misconduct embody adultery, cruelty, abandonment, or felony conviction. The petitioning partner should current ample proof to the courtroom to substantiate these claims.

Establishing fault in a Texas divorce case can considerably influence the result, notably relating to property division and spousal help. Whereas Texas adheres to neighborhood property rules, the courtroom might award a disproportionate share of property to the non-faulting occasion, particularly if egregious conduct contributed to monetary losses. Moreover, proving fault can strengthen a declare for spousal upkeep, particularly if the opposite partner is discovered responsible of home violence or different severe misconduct. Traditionally, fault grounds supplied the first foundation for divorce proceedings earlier than the appearance of no-fault choices, and proceed to supply strategic benefits in sure circumstances.
